Morgan Gopnik is a scholar working on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law, Ecology and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Morgan Gopnik has authored 5 papers receiving a total of 206 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 3 papers in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law, 2 papers in Ecology and 1 paper in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Morgan Gopnik’s work include Coastal and Marine Management (3 papers), Coral and Marine Ecosystems Studies (2 papers) and Social Acceptance of Renewable Energy (1 paper). Morgan Gopnik is often cited by papers focused on Coastal and Marine Management (3 papers), Coral and Marine Ecosystems Studies (2 papers) and Social Acceptance of Renewable Energy (1 paper). Morgan Gopnik collaborates with scholars based in United States. Morgan Gopnik's co-authors include Kate McClellan, Larry B. Crowder, Linwood H. Pendleton, Clare Fieseler, Adrian Jordaan, Andy J. Danylchuk, C. E. Kolb and Raymond C. Loehr and has published in prestigious journals such as Eos, Marine Policy and Coastal Management.
